With a DMP, you make one regular monthly payment to the credit rating therapy firm. Those funds are then distributed to lenders of your unprotected financial obligations, such as bank card and installment lendings. The agency works with your lenders to reduce rate of interest or forgo costs, however some financial institutions might reject such concessions.

The letter might confirm you do not owe what the debt collector's documents reveal. Yes, for the most part, the IRS thinks about forgiven financial debt as taxable revenue. When a loan provider forgives $600 or even more, they are needed to send you Form 1099-C.

Financial obligation forgiveness or negotiation nearly constantly hurts your credit rating. Anytime you work out a financial obligation for much less than you owe, it may show up as "cleared up" on your credit rating record and affect your credit rating for seven years from the date of negotiation. Your credit can also go down considerably in the months causing the forgiveness if you drop behind on repayments.

The application procedure for an Offer in Concession involves numerous comprehensive steps. First, you should finish and send IRS Type 656, the Deal in Concession application, and Kind 433-A (OIC), a collection information statement for people. These kinds need extensive economic details, including information about your earnings, financial debts, expenditures, and possessions.

Back taxes, which are unsettled taxes from previous years, can substantially boost your total IRS financial debt if not addressed quickly. This debt can build up interest and late settlement penalties, making the original amount owed a lot bigger with time. Failure to pay back taxes can cause the internal revenue service taking enforcement actions, such as issuing a tax lien or levy against your building.

It is necessary to resolve back tax obligations asap, either by paying the complete amount owed or by arranging a layaway plan with the internal revenue service. By taking aggressive actions, you can stay clear of the buildup of extra passion and fines, and prevent a lot more aggressive collection actions by the internal revenue service.
